Tell us what applications you want to run, what CPU you're currently
running and if they are currently responsive enough. My instinct is to
go for AMD simply because South Africans (irrationally) prefer the
bigger brand (Intel) and importers and retails will build it into the
price.

I disagree with Hilton regarding 64-bit being essential. If you never
use 4 GB RAM then the extra transistors in a 64-bit laptop will just
increase your battery consumption unnecessarily.
